Robot Vacuum Cleaner Maintenance

It's vital to maintain your robot vacuum to ensure it is clean of all the spots within your home. These steps will ensure that the vacuum performs at its best robot vacuum and robotic vacuum cleaner sale lasts as long as possible.

The majority of robotic cleaners come with sensors that can detect and respond to areas of high traffic. These areas will be cleaned thoroughly by making extra passes. You can carry on your day without worrying about whether the floors are clean enough to accommodate guests. You can schedule cleaning sessions using a robot vacuum even when you're away for work or for a vacation. This will ensure that your floors remain clean and pristine, so you can return home to a house which has been thoroughly cleaned.

Before you start the cleaning process, take out anything that your robot could get stuck on. This includes toys and cords as well as loose furniture. Also, be sure to move any delicate floor decorations to a different area or cover them with a cloth.

The next step is to clean the vacuum's filter(s). This may be done as frequently as once a month, based on how frequently you use the vacuum. It is as simple as taking the filter out of the vacuum and then gently tapping it in a trash container to get rid of dust and dirt. If your vacuum comes with multiple filters, be sure to clean them thoroughly and allow each to dry before reinserting them.

Make sure the bin isn't overflowing. A full bin can hamper your vacuum's suction power and put too much strain on the motor. After every use, empty the dust bin.

It is also recommended to clean the robot's charging dock regularly to ensure there isn't any dirt or debris blocking its connections. You should also wash the water container for cleaning and wipe the battery compartment down with a damp towel.

Robot Vacuum Cleaner Replacement Parts

Many robot vacuum cleaners have various attachments to deal with different floor surfaces, from floors that are unfinished to carpets with low pile. Many also come with mopping functions that use rotating pads to deal with the mess that can be found on hard floors and rug. These robots are able to handle a variety of flooring materials such as textures, obstacles like cords, toys, and pet waste. They can detect changes in surface type, allowing them adjust automatically and offer more thorough cleaning than conventional vacuums.

They are not as effective at collecting dirt from rugs and dust on baseboards. They can be tripped up by toys or cords and they could miss piles of dust and debris that aren't obvious to the naked eye. You'll still require a traditional vacuum cleaner to do deeper cleanings.

These machines can also be loud, which could disrupt the peace and quiet of a home. This is especially true when the robot is in high suction mode, or is navigating small spaces. ECOVACS robots have been developed to reduce noise through their optimized motor design and suction settings that can be adjusted. Regular maintenance, like emptying the dustbin and cleaning the filters, can aid in reducing noises.

Other problems include clogs, the loss of power or electrical issues. Regular inspections of your robot's filters, brush rolls, and other components will allow you to spot these issues before they become costly and threatening. Many of these problems can be resolved with simple DIY fixes, like replacing worn-out parts, or by following the manual's maintenance and cleaning instructions. If the problem persists, seeking professional repair or customer support services might be necessary.
